The A32 Dante supports a wealth of audio formats-making it an exceptional choice for a myriad of environments. The unit supports 64 channels of Dante, 64 channels of MADI I/O, 32 channels of ADAT optical I/O, and 32 channels of analog I/O.

Audio can be freely routed (in groups of 8) between all interfaces. As an example, it is possible to use the first 32 Dante channels for converting to analog while using the remaining 32 Dante channels to connect the A32 Dante with ADAT or MADI equipment.

The unit can be used for example to expand I/O for your recording system. By connection equipment to the analog port, and route it to Dante, it can be recorded into your DAW using Dante virtual soundcard.

The Ferrofish A32‘s 400 MHz Sharc DSP facilitates extremely precise audio calculations to ensure that, on the digital side, not a single bit is lost. The result is stunning audio performance throughout.

Stability first : 2 power supplies for redundancy, also Dante and MADI redundancy.
